Document background
A Defamation Of Character Cease And Desist Letter is a crucial legal tool in Singapore's legal framework for addressing reputational damage. It is typically used when an individual or entity has identified specific defamatory statements that harm their reputation and wishes to stop further dissemination without immediate court intervention. The document must comply with Singapore's Defamation Act and may also involve provisions from the Protection from Harassment Act, particularly for online defamation. It serves as both a formal warning and a documented attempt at resolution before pursuing more costly legal proceedings.
Suggested Sections

1. Sender Details: Full name, address, and contact information of the aggrieved party or their legal representative

2. Recipient Details: Full name and address of the person who made the defamatory statements

3. Defamatory Statement Description: Specific details of the defamatory statements, including dates, locations, and medium of publication

4. Legal Basis: Citation of relevant laws (Defamation Act and POHA) and explanation of how the statements constitute defamation

5. Demand for Action: Clear demands for ceasing defamatory statements and removing existing content

6. Deadline: Specific timeframe for compliance with demands

7. Legal Consequences: Statement of potential legal action if demands are not met

Optional Sections

1. Previous Communications: Reference to any prior attempts to resolve the matter, used when there has been previous correspondence

2. Damage Description: Details of specific harm caused by the defamation, used when tangible damages can be demonstrated

3. Request for Written Apology: Demand for public retraction and apology, used when reputation restoration is priority

Suggested Schedules

1. Evidence of Defamatory Statements: Screenshots, printouts, or copies of the defamatory content

2. Evidence of Damages: Documentation of financial or reputational harm caused by the defamation

3. Previous Correspondence: Copies of any relevant prior communications between parties

Defamation Act (Chapter 75): Primary legislation governing defamation in Singapore, covering both libel and slander, defining defamatory statements and outlining available remedies

Protection from Harassment Act (POHA): Additional legislation providing protection against harassment and false statements, particularly relevant for online defamation and repeated behavior

Elements of Defamation: Legal requirements: publication of statement, statement must be defamatory, must refer to plaintiff, and must be communicated to third party

Defense of Justification: Legal defense based on proving the truth of the defamatory statement

Defense of Fair Comment: Legal defense for statements that are honest expressions of opinion on matters of public interest

Defense of Absolute Privilege: Legal defense for statements made in certain privileged contexts (e.g., parliamentary proceedings)

Defense of Qualified Privilege: Legal defense for statements made in circumstances where there is a duty to communicate information

Defense of Innocent Dissemination: Legal defense available to those who unknowingly distribute defamatory material

Limitation Period: 6-year time limit from date of publication to initiate legal proceedings for defamation

Jurisdictional Considerations: Legal principles regarding Singapore courts' jurisdiction, particularly important for online defamation cases
